Le métier de développeur web évolue à une vitesse folle. Face à la multiplicité des technologies, frameworks et nouveaux usages, il devient crucial de se doter des outils incontournables pour le développeur web moderne. Que vous soyez débutant ou freelance aguerri, disposer d'une boîte à outils adaptée, à jour et performante peut faire toute la différence sur un projet. Outre la productivité, c’est aussi votre capacité à innover, à collaborer efficacement et à livrer des produits robustes qui est en jeu.
Dans cet article, plongeons ensemble dans un panorama complet des meilleures solutions pour le développement web. Des environnements de code aux outils de qualité, en passant par la gestion de projet et les tendances technologiques, je partage ici mes ressources, bonnes pratiques et retours terrain d’indépendant. Préparez-vous à découvrir comment ces outils peuvent transformer votre quotidien et pourquoi il est vital, parfois, de faire appel à un expert du domaine pour s’y retrouver.
Bien choisir son environnement de développement
L'environnement de développement est l'épicentre de toute activité de programmation. Il ne s'agit plus aujourd'hui de se contenter d'un éditeur de texte basique : la complexité des projets et l’exigence en matière de déploiement imposent des solutions puissantes, flexibles et évolutives.
Les éditeurs de code : VS Code, Sublime Text et Atom
Le débat autour du « meilleur » éditeur de code anime toujours la communauté. Visual Studio Code (VS Code) s’affirme comme la référence actuelle pour développeurs web. Grâce à son écosystème d’extensions, il permet d’ajouter des fonctionnalités (intégration de l’autocomplétion, débogueur, Git, etc.) en quelques clics. Simple à prendre en main, il séduit autant les juniors que les seniors. Sublime Text reste apprécié pour sa rapidité et sa légèreté. Atom, quant à lui, attire par sa flexibilité et sa personnalisation, bien que moins populaire aujourd’hui.
- Visual Studio Code : open source, personnalisable, multiplateforme.
- Sublime Text : ultra-rapide, idéal pour les scripts légers.
- Atom : code collaboratif facilité, ergonomie agréable.
Adopter un éditeur performant permet de gagner un temps précieux, d’éviter les erreurs (grâce aux linter et correcteurs intégrés) et de se concentrer sur la logique métier. Il n’est pas rare qu’en tant que freelance, la vitesse d’exécution fasse la différence lors d’un appel d’offres ou d’un sprint décisif.
Les environnements de développement intégrés (IDE) spécialisés
Pour des applications complexes ou des projets nécessitant une architecture avancée, les IDE professionnels comme WebStorm ou PHPStorm font figure de choix privilégiés. Ces outils offrent :
- Une gestion avancée des dépendances et des frameworks (React, Angular, Vue.js, Symfony, etc.).
- Des outils d’analyse de code pointus qui permettent un gain en fiabilité.
- Un support natif pour le testing, le versionnage et l’intégration continue.
Lorsque la stabilité et la pérennité sont de mise, s’appuyer sur ces environnements sécurise le développement — un argument de poids auprès de vos clients. Parfois, il est même préférable de confier cette partie à un développeur expérimenté, qui saura optimiser l’intégralité de la stack technique.
La virtualisation et le Cloud : Docker, GitHub Codespaces
La virtualisation des environnements via Docker devient peu à peu un standard. Plus question de « ça marche chez moi mais pas chez toi » grâce à la conteneurisation ! Docker permet d’isoler les dépendances, de tester toutes les configurations et de déployer n’importe où. GitHub Codespaces révolutionne la manière d’aborder le dev à distance : un poste de travail complet, accessible dans votre navigateur, avec synchronisation instantanée et partage de code en équipe.
- Docker : déploiement reproductible, gestion fine de la configuration.
- GitHub Codespaces : productivité à distance, collaboration boostée.
Ces outils, en pleine explosion (Docker est utilisé selon Statista par plus de 50% des développeurs en 2024), requièrent un minimum de prise en main. Dans bien des cas, l’accompagnement par un prestataire qualifié permet d’implémenter ces solutions rapidement et sans risques.
Outils collaboratifs et gestion de projet
L’organisation et la communication sont les clés du succès dans le développement web moderne. Qu’il s’agisse de travailler en équipe ou de gérer des clients, les outils collaboratifs sont désormais incontournables.
Le versionnement de code avec Git et GitHub
Incontournable pour tout projet, Git est le mécanisme central de gestion du code source. Son couple avec GitHub (ou GitLab, Bitbucket) permet à plusieurs développeurs de travailler simultanément, de suivre chaque modification et de garantir la traçabilité de l'ensemble du projet. En freelance, cela permet aussi de rassurer les clients : chaque avancement est documenté, chaque patch est réversible.
- Branching : création de fonctionnalités sans impacter la version principale.
- Pull requests : revue du code, feedbacks rapides.
- Actions GitHub : automatisation des déploiements.
L’intégration de Git à votre workflow limitera drastiquement les conflits de code et accélérera la livraison finale. Mais pour tirer pleinement parti de ces outils, un accompagnement par un développeur habitué aux workflows avancés peut être décisif.
Communication et gestion de tâches : Slack, Trello, Notion
Avec le télétravail et le mode projet, la communication asynchrone prend tout son sens. Slack s’impose comme le hub central de messagerie où tous vos échanges sont organisés par sujet ou client. Trello et Notion se partagent quant à eux la gestion de tâches : Trello mise sur la simplicité du Kanban, là où Notion excelle dans l’organisation personnalisée, allant du CRM au suivi de sprint.
- Slack : échanges instantanés, intégrations multiples (calendrier, outils de bugtracking, CI/CD).
- Trello : visualisation claire, priorisation des tâches.
- Notion : base de connaissances, documents partagés, templates divers.
Gérer un projet web moderne c’est jongler entre idées, deadlines et feedbacks clients en permanence. Ces outils fluidifient la collaboration, rendent le travail transparent et accélèrent la prise de décision. D’autant plus que, mal paramétrés, ils peuvent générer de la confusion : l’aide d’un professionnel dans leur déploiement ou leur personnalisation est souvent salvatrice.
Méthodologies agiles et points de suivi
L'adoption des méthodes Agile transforme les modes de production numériques. Scrum et Kanban permettent d’avancer par étapes, avec des points réguliers, des livrables progressifs et des feedbacks immédiats. L'utilisation d’outils comme Jira pour le suivi ou Miro pour les ateliers collaboratifs favorisent l’implication de tous et la visibilité des avancements.
- Découpage du projet en « user stories » claires.
- Livrables fréquents pour valider chaque étape.
- Visualisation constante de la roadmap.
Ces pratiques, si elles sont bien appliquées, offrent un cadre propice à la réussite. Mais en l'absence de compétences en pilotage, mieux vaut appuyer la gestion sur l’expérience d’un indépendant aguerri.
Productivité et automatisation au service du développeur
Automatiser les tâches répétitives et optimiser le développement est désormais essentiel pour gagner en productivité et garantir la qualité.
Les gestionnaires de paquets : npm, Yarn, Composer
Installer, mettre à jour et organiser ses dépendances est devenu un passage obligé pour tout développeur web moderne. npm (Node Package Manager) est la référence pour les apps JavaScript, tandis que Yarn offre une approche plus rapide et fiable, idéale pour les projets de grande ampleur. Côté PHP, Composer gère efficacement toutes les librairies tierces.
- npm : vaste écosystème de packages, popularité croissante.
- Yarn : rapidité d’installation, meilleur caching.
- Composer : gestion fine pour projets backend PHP.
Un bon usage des gestionnaires de paquets réduit le temps passé sur l’installation et la résolution de bugs, tout en assurant la sécurité des mises à jour. Mais mal gérés, ils peuvent entraîner des conflits compliqués à démêler — une situation que seul un œil averti saura éviter.
Automatisation des tâches : Webpack, Gulp, Grunt
La compilation des fichiers, l’optimisation des images ou le minification du CSS… Autant de tâches qui, si elles sont faites à la main, ralentissent inutilement la progression d’un projet. Webpack s’impose comme LE standard pour packager toutes les ressources. Gulp et Grunt permettent de monter rapidement des pipelines d’automatisation qui simplifient la vie au quotidien.
- Webpack : modules centralisés, support front-end/TV/IoT.
- Gulp : automatisations rapides pour projets personnalisés.
- Grunt : scripting simple adapté aux petits scripts.
Une configuration mal pensée de ces outils peut peser lourdement sur les performances d’un site — mais bien paramétrés, ils boostent la productivité et limitent les erreurs.
Outils de test et assurance qualité : Jest, Cypress, PHPUnit
La fiabilité d’un produit web dépend de la rigueur des tests. Jest automatise les tests unitaires côté JavaScript, Cypress s’attèle à la simulation du parcours utilisateur et PHPUnit gère les tests automatisés PHP. Leur usage est en hausse de 38% depuis 2022 (source : Stack Overflow Survey 2024) car ils réduisent drastiquement les bugfixs post-production.
- Jest : tests rapides côté front.
- Cypress : scénarios interactifs sur navigateurs réels.
- PHPUnit : automatisation des tests serveur.
Ces outils participent au respect des délais et à l’amélioration continue. Prendre le temps de les intégrer avec justesse demande de l’expérience : n’hésitez pas à solliciter un pro du domaine pour fiabiliser vos déploiements.
Tendances, inspiration et veille : rester à la pointe
Rester informé des tendances et des derniers outils du développement web est indispensable pour ne pas prendre de retard technologique. La veille, la formation continue et le partage sont des piliers pour tout professionnel.
Les plateformes de veille et de formation : GitHub, Stack Overflow, Medium
GitHub n’est pas qu’un hébergeur de code : c’est la première source de découverte de packages, d’outils open source novateurs et de projets inspirants. Stack Overflow reste la référence pour tout problème technique : une réponse bien formulée y trouve quasi toujours écho. Medium, quant à lui, permet de suivre des experts et d’approfondir des sujets via des articles concis et pertinents.
- GitHub : démos, forks, documentation communautaire.
- Stack Overflow : entraide rapide, astuces pratico-pratiques.
- Medium : veille sur les nouveaux frameworks et librairies.
L’utilisation régulière de ces plateformes nourrit la curiosité et l’agilité. Mais il n’est pas évident de trier l’information, de choisir les outils adaptés : la démarche, parfois chronophage, est souvent optimisée par un intervenant expérimenté qui vous oriente directement vers la solution qui vous correspond.
UX/UI design et prototypage rapide : Figma, Adobe XD, Sketch
La frontière entre code et design disparaît peu à peu. Figma, Adobe XD et Sketch permettent de prototyper une interface, d’obtenir des retours clients en un temps record, et même de générer du code CSS prêt à l’emploi. Ils sont incontournables pour :
- Créer des mockups interactifs.
- Faciliter la communication avec des profils non techniques.
- Accélérer la validation des maquettes.
À l’ère de l’expérience utilisateur, intégrer ces outils améliore la relation client et renforce la cohérence de votre projet. Leur maîtrise avancée n’est pas innée : faire appel à un développeur ou designer UX/UI freelance est souvent le choix gagnant.
Les newsletters, podcasts et conférences pour ne rien rater
Enfin, pour rester « dans le coup », rien de mieux que de s’abonner à quelques newsletters de référence (Frontend Mentor, Smashing Magazine), de suivre des podcasts comme Code Café ou DevTheory (très plébiscités en 2024 par la communauté française) et de participer à des meetups locaux ou à des conférences en ligne.
- Newsletters : veille synthétique hebdomadaire.
- Podcasts : interviews et retours d’expérience.
- Conférences : workshops en live, retours terrain.
Cette veille active permet de rester à la page, d’anticiper de nouveaux usages… et d’éviter l'obsolescence. Mais là encore, un accompagnement personnalisé par un freelance veilleur facilite l’adoption des tendances les plus pertinentes pour votre cas concret.
Pourquoi faire appel à un prestataire qualifié ?
Au fil de cet article, vous avez sans doute mesuré à quel point la panoplie d’un développeur web moderne est vaste, dynamique… et parfois complexe à maîtriser seul. Les outils incontournables ne sont pas que des logiciels : ce sont aussi des méthodes, des pratiques et des choix stratégiques qui, s’ils sont mal abordés, peuvent retarder voire compromettre un projet.
Gagner du temps, limiter les erreurs et sécuriser son projet
Un prestataire chevronné repère instantanément les outils adaptés à la réalité de votre application, configure vos workflows sans tunnel d’apprentissage fastidieux, et assure une montée en compétence fluide pour votre équipe ou vos clients. Vous économisez temps et ressources, tout en sécurisant chaque étape : de l’installation à la livraison, aucun détail n’est laissé au hasard.
Bénéficier d’un regard extérieur et de solutions sur-mesure
Chaque projet est unique. Passer par un freelance expérimenté, c’est accéder à :
- Des méthodes éprouvées et toujours à la page.
- Un mix optimal entre tradition (outils robustes) et innovation (veille sur les nouvelles pratiques).
- Une écoute et une réactivité dédiées, même sur les cas complexes.
Nombre de mes clients, après avoir testé seul plusieurs solutions, réalisent que l’adaptation sur-mesure, le support et l’optimisation continue font toute la différence sur la durée.
Passer d’un idéal technique à un résultat concret
Le développement web, ce n’est pas que choisir des outils : c’est orchestrer l’ensemble pour atteindre les objectifs métiers. Le bon expert saura transformer vos ambitions digitales en solutions stables, évolutives et pleinement adoptées par vos utilisateurs.
Conclusion : Faites de vos outils vos meilleurs alliés
Les outils incontournables pour le développeur web moderne ne se résument pas à une simple checklist à cocher : il s’agit d’un écosystème, vivant et minutieux, qui ne cesse d’évoluer. Entre automatisation, collaboration, veille, design et gestion de projet, chaque solution appliquée libère du potentiel… à condition qu’elle soit parfaitement maîtrisée.
Que vous soyez à la tête d'une startup, indépendant ou responsable numérique d’une PME, n'oubliez pas qu’une expertise externe, adaptée à vos process, fait souvent la différence entre un site qui stagne et un projet qui cartonne. En tant que freelance développeur web, je vous accompagne pas à pas dans ce changement d’ère. Prêt à passer à la vitesse supérieure ?
